Blauvac ( French Blauvac ) is a commune in the French department of Vaucluse of the Provence-Alpes-Côte d'Azur region . Refers to the canton of Mormuaron .

Blovac is located 32 km northeast of Avignon . Neighboring communes: Mormuaron in the north, Ville-sur-Ozon in the northeast, Metami in the southeast, Malmor du Comte in the southwest, Mazan in the northwest.
Hydrography
The commune stands on the Nesk river.
Demographics
The population of the commune for 2010 was 447 people.
| 1962 | 1968 | 1975 | 1982 | 1990 | 1999 | 2010 |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 198 | 198 | 215 | 228 | 274 | 337 | 447 |
